Fundamental Blackjack Strategies
Implementing basic strategies is the cornerstone of successful blackjack play. These strategies are derived from extensive computer simulations and statistical analyses, offering players the lowest possible house edge—typically around 0.5% when executed correctly. The core elements include knowing when to hit, stand, double down, or split.
For example, if your initial hand totals 8 or less, hitting is usually advisable, whereas standing on a hard 17 or higher minimizes risk. Learning these plays can reduce the house advantage and increase your long-term profitability.
Myths vs. Facts: Card Counting
| Myth | Fact |
|---|---|
| Card counting is illegal in casinos. | While casinos may prohibit counters, it is not illegal. However, it can lead to being banned from the premises. |
| Card counting guarantees a win. | It provides an advantage, often around 1-2%, but it does not ensure consistent winnings, especially in online variants. |
Most players underestimate the skill and discipline required for effective card counting, which involves keeping track of high and low cards to inform betting decisions. Modern online blackjack, especially with multiple decks and continuous shuffling, significantly reduces its effectiveness.
Bankroll Management Techniques
Effective bankroll management is essential to sustain play and avoid significant losses. Experts recommend setting a fixed budget—say, $100 for a session—and sticking to it regardless of temporary gains or losses. This approach prevents chasing losses and helps maintain a long-term perspective.
Additionally, adjusting your bet sizes according to your bankroll—using units of 1-5% of your total funds—can prolong gameplay and improve the chances of hitting positive streaks. For example, if you have $500, a conservative bet might be $10.
Using a systematic approach, such as the Kelly Criterion, can optimize betting amounts based on the perceived advantage, but it requires precise knowledge of your edge, which is often limited in blackjack.
Optimal Split and Double Down Strategies
Maximizing returns involves knowing when to split pairs or double your initial wager. For instance, splitting Aces and 8s is generally advantageous, as it increases your chances of forming strong hands or avoiding poor totals.
Double down is most beneficial when the dealer’s upcard is weak—such as 4, 5, or 6—and your total is 9, 10, or 11. This move allows you to double your bet with a single additional card, effectively doubling potential winnings.
